Iglesia Placita Olvera
March 13, 2025
La Placita: La Iglesia de Nuestra Señora la Reina de los Ángeles – Los Angeles Explorers Guild La Placita: La Iglesia de Nuestra Señora la Reina de los Ángeles – Los Angeles Explorers Guild La Placita Church La Placita – Our Lady of the Angels Church | Iglesia Placita Olvera